So, I've got a Boss RV2 that I like to use for plate reverbs. I like the sound of it, but I don't use it that often and I don't really use any of the other sounds on it. I was thinking about getting an RV5 for modulated reverb. How much does the plate on the RV5 sound like the RV2? Would it be able to replace the RV2? What do you think?

I've owned both (though not at the same time.) They're definitely different. It may be suitable for your needs, but don't count it a sure thing.

I first got the RV-5 because I wanted to recreate the plate verb sounds from the RV-3, but found the RV-5 much too "clean" and "smooth" as compared to the RV-3.

...as for the other reverb suggestions people are offering, I was maybe unclear. I'm not looking for a different plate sound. I was looking to see if I could find something that did the same plate sound. I've got a Verbzilla. It's cool for lots of stuff, but the plate is nothing like the RV2. It's weird, I've gone through a ton of reverbs, and I haven't heard another plate that matches up much with the RV2. The Verbzilla's plate is sounds a bit too atmospheric, distant. Others, like the Digiverb, are too trebly (especially with distortion).
